Before this change loading of a packerconfig would display `loaded plugin ...` for any plugin defined in the packerconfig - even if it didn't exist on disk. This change updates how plugins defined in packerconfig are loaded to ensure that only successfully loaded plugins get the lovely message `loaded plugin ...`. For any plugin that fails to load Packer will log that it failed to load the plugin and continue processing any other defined plugins. * Add a test to ensure loadSingleComponent errors when plugin does not exists
